This issue has still not been resolved for me. Ticket submitted back in January (Ticket 159964) had some efforts from the support team regarding an updated firmware that did not resolve the issue. The cameras have since seen at least one regular firmware update with no change. Currently on 4.9.4.37

To clarify, for me, the problem is intermittent. It is however ALWAYS related to low bit-rate streams. For whatever reason when the camera bit rate drops below say 35-40 KB/s any triggered or manual recording exhibits the problem (fast playback and incorrectly reported duration). When in IR (night) mode bit-rates are normal and records are fine. I first thought it might be signal related as the problem was with two of my cameras that were farthest form the router, but this has not been consistently the case. Just today one camera was streaming at 130 KB/s+ and the one right next to it was at 20 KB/s. WiFi signal was 90% and 88% respectively. I am at a loss to try and explain this (as I think Wyze support is as well). Again the really weird part is the moment I switch to IR/night mode bit-rates pop up to normal (120 KB/s+) and records are played back just fine.
